Thank you for your interest in teaching for Tillamook Bay Community College's Continuing and Community Education Program. Our mission is to provide quality lifelong learning that is responsive and accessible to the citizens of Tillamook County. Our classes are generated from the philosophy that learning is a rewarding, lifelong experience that occurs most fully in a relaxed, supportive atmosphere.
The best instructor candidates for our program are individuals who combine a sincere interest in community service with a desire to supplement their existing income. Although our compensation is competitive with other continuing education programs around the state, it must be understood that it cannot be regarded as primary employment. We cannot offer full-time employment to our instructors, nor is teaching for us a route to full-time employment with our program. Nonetheless, we are very interested in developing long-term relationships with successful instructors.

Before completing the course proposal form, we ask that you review the information at right. We then invite you to complete all sections of the online course proposal form.
Each quarter submitted course proposals will be reviewed. If your course is selected, you will be notified. If we are unable to integrate your proposal into our present course offerings, it will be kept on file for future consideration. |
